Output 169a8490544d56d6df0f80ce4cac204c72f52114263ae1960c013a97eb0e42c0:8

value
1376000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ebfa7bdbb5e162e63b9ff3b94b40fe2dbdaf0c OP_EQUAL
address
3QPCCBrjd8pH86j8ftGQo9UGUWfqa4DBD3
transaction
169a8490544d56d6df0f80ce4cac204c72f52114263ae1960c013a97eb0e42c0
spent
true